Today's Feature Song = 'Crazy For You' by Best Coast (2010)
Today's feature song is Crazy for You by American indie-garage-pop trio Best Coast. Best Coast are based in Los Angeles, California and its members are Bethany Cosentino ( songwriter/lead vocals), Bobb Bruno (multiple-instruments) and Ali Koehler (drums). This song appears as the second track of of their Crazy for You album, which was released in July, 2010 on the Mexican Summer Record Label. The album peaked at #36 on the US Album Charts upon its release. The Song for December 10th, 2010: "Janglin" by Edward Sharpe and the Magnetic Zeroes
Today's song is...Janglin, by American indie-folk group Edward Sharpe and the Magnetic Zeroes. Well, this is the 3rd song off of the 2009 release Up From Below album by Edward Sharpe and the Magnetic Zeroes. In case you missed the last posts, Edward Sharpe and the Magnetic Zeroes have been out on the music scene since 2005 and are based out of Los Angeles, California, USA. They have a delightful folkish sound, and this album is highly recommended by yours truly. The band has heaps of members and musicians, but its primarily lead by vocalist Alex Ebert (also the vocalist for another pop group called Ima Robot). Song of the Day for September 26th, 2010: "Stand Tall" by Dirty Heads
And the song of the day is...Stand Tall by American reggae-rock band Dirty Heads. Dirty Heads consist of members Jared Watson, Dustin "Duddy" Bushnell, Jon Olazabal, Matt Ochoa, and David Foral and they are based out of Huntington Beach, California. Stand Tall came off of their 2008 debut album release titled Any Port in a Storm and it was featured in a Sony Pictures film called Surf's Up. This album would peak at #55 on the US Album Chart in 2008. This band has a laid-back beachy sound, no doubt about that, and yet they also contain some elements of indie rock which makes for an interesting blend, I highly recommend checking out their album.

Song of the Day for September 20th, 2010: "Up from Below" by Edward Sharpe and the Magnetic Zeros
And the song is...Up from Below by American folk-rock-indie group Edward Sharpe and the Magnetic Zeros. Edward Sharpe and the Magnetic Zeros come out of Los Angeles, California, and they consist of members Alex Ebert, Jade Castrinos, Nico Aglietti, Christian Letts, Stewart Cole, Tay Strathairn, Aaron Older, Josh Collazo, Orpheo McCord, and Nora Kirkpatrick. This song comes off of their July 7th, 2009 release album of the same name. They are best known for their hit song titled Home, which can be found on the same album.
